In a world dominated by smartphones, the humble feature phone still holds appeal for its simplicity, affordability, and exceptional battery life. Today, we're pitting two popular contenders against each other: the Nokia 6310 (2021) and the Nokia 150. Let's see which one comes out on top.
🏆 Quick Verdict
The Nokia 6310 (2021) offers a significant upgrade over the Nokia 150 with its larger screen, improved performance thanks to the Unisoc chipset, and added features like a camera and games. While the 150 remains a budget champion, the 6310 provides better overall value for a slightly higher price.

Display Comparison
The Nokia 6310 (2021) boasts a 2.4-inch QVGA display, a noticeable upgrade from the Nokia 150's smaller, lower-resolution screen. This larger display makes text easier to read and provides a more enjoyable experience for browsing and playing games.
Camera Comparison
The Nokia 6310 (2021) includes a basic VGA camera, allowing for simple snapshots. The Nokia 150 lacks a camera entirely, focusing solely on communication.
Performance
The Nokia 6310 (2021) utilizes a Unisoc 6531F chipset, offering a performance boost compared to the Nokia 150's unknown chipset. This translates to smoother navigation, faster app loading (for the limited apps available), and a more responsive user experience. The 150 prioritizes efficiency over speed.
Battery Life
Both phones offer exceptional battery life, a hallmark of feature phones. However, the Nokia 150, with its less demanding hardware, likely edges out the 6310 in sheer endurance, potentially lasting several days on a single charge.
Buying Guide
The Nokia 6310 (2021) is ideal for those seeking a basic phone with a few extra features, a slightly larger display, and a bit more processing power for games. The Nokia 150 is perfect for users prioritizing extreme affordability, longest possible battery life, and a truly minimalist experience – essentially a reliable communication device.
